I have 2 Mf 165s, and recently i aquired a MF 40 loader. i was wondering if any one would know what the loader would be fit to lift if it fiited it to the 165.
would it lift a silage bale for instance which averages 800kg upwards.

The only method I could suggest to is to look up what the loader should lift from manufactures spec. If not that find a model that looks the same as to cylinder diameter and stroke. Next point if it looks like it will fit then attach it. At 800kg or 1800LBs only your pressure and cylinder diameter will determine that. Next point that is a 2 wheel drive tractor. As you put more weight on the front the traction gets worse on the back.
